Let us therefore respect the goodness of Christ, let us be ashamed before his sufferings, let us not make his wounds in vain, let us not prefer shameful pleasure to his good pleasure and command, let us not repay the benefactor with evils, let us not take his members and make them members of a prostitute; for we are not our own masters; we were bought with a price. Who then sold us, or who bought us? The devil sold us through sin, Christ redeemed us through righteousness. But how did he buy us? By giving gold, or silver? No, but his own blood which is much more precious than gold and stone; for he bought all our sins; and they are many, and in various and different ways they disturb our salvation.
What sins? Those of the law; but not that the law is sin, may it not be so; but that apart from the law 60.708 I did not know sin. Since, therefore, the law made me liable to a curse as a transgressor, for this reason Jesus Christ came and redeemed me from the curse of the law, having become a curse for us. Let us not, therefore, prefer the universal providence of the devil to the economy of Christ; let us not, for the sake of sin, run past the beauty of repentance. If you fear the threat, take refuge in the commandment; if you wish to escape the coming judgment, turn away from evil, and do good; that is, put away sin, and become a worker of repentance, so that he who does not will the death of sinners but that they should turn and live, having accepted the eagerness of your soul, may grant you the forgiveness of sin; and let us for the things that have been said send up praise and glory to the Father and to the Son and to the Holy Spirit, now and ever, and unto the ages of ages. Amen.

Αἰδεσθῶμεν οὖν τὴν τοῦ Χριστοῦ ἀγαθότητα, ἐντράπωμεν αὐτοῦ τὰ πάθη, μὴ ματαιώσωμεν αὐτοῦ τοὺς μώλωπας, μὴ τὴν αἰσχρὰν ἡδονὴν τῆς καλῆς αὐτοῦ προκρίνωμεν ἡδονῆς καὶ ἐντολῆς, μὴ κακοῖς τὸν εὐεργέτην ἀμειψώμεθα, μὴ λάβωμεν αὐτοῦ τὰ μέλη, καὶ ποιήσωμεν πόρνης μέλη· οὐκ ἐσμὲν γὰρ ἑαυτῶν κύριοι· τιμῆς ἠγοράσθημεν. Τίς δὲ ἡμᾶς ἀπέδοτο, ἢ τίς ἡμᾶς ὠνήσατο; Ὁ διάβολος ἡμᾶς ἀπέδοτο διὰ τῆς ἁμαρτίας, ὁ Χριστὸς ἡμᾶς ἐξηγόρασε διὰ τῆς δικαιοσύνης. Πῶς δὲ ἡμᾶς ἠγόρασε; χρυσίον, ἢ ἀργύριον δούς; Οὐχὶ, ἀλλὰ τὸ οἰκεῖον αἷμα τὸ ὑπὲρ χρυσίον καὶ λίθον τίμιον πολύ· πάσας γὰρ ἡμῶν τὰς ἁμαρτίας ἠγόρασε· πολλαὶ δέ εἰσι, καὶ ποικίλως καὶ διαφόρως ἐνοχλοῦσαι ἡμῶν τὴν σωτηρίαν.
Ποίας ἁμαρτίας; Τὰς τοῦ νόμου· ἀλλ' οὐχ ὅτι ὁ νόμος ἁμαρτία, μὴ γένοιτο· ἀλλ' ὅτι ἐκτὸς νόμου ἁμαρτίαν 60.708 οὐκ ᾔδειν. Ἐπεὶ οὖν ὁ νόμος ὡς παραβάτην με ἔνοχον κατάρας ἐποίει, διὰ τοῦτο ἐλθὼν ὁ Χριστὸς Ἰησοῦς ἐξηγόρασέ με ἐκ τῆς κατάρας τοῦ νόμου, γενόμενος ὑπὲρ ἡμῶν κατάρα. Μὴ τὴν πάνδημον οὖν πρόνοιαν τοῦ διαβόλου προκρίνωμεν τῆς οἰκονομίας τοῦ Χριστοῦ· μὴ πρὸς χάριν τῆς ἁμαρτίας παραδράμωμεν τῆς μετανοίας τὸ κάλλος. Εἰ φοβῇ τὴν ἀπειλὴν, κατάφυγε ἐπὶ τὴν ἐντολήν· εἰ μὲν μέλλουσαν κρίσιν ἀποδρᾶσαι θέλεις, ἔκκλινον ἀπὸ κακοῦ, καὶ ποίησον ἀγαθόν· τουτέστιν, ἀπόθου τὴν ἁμαρτίαν, καὶ ἐργάτης γένου τῆς μετανοίας, ἵνα ὁ μὴ βουλόμενος τὸν θάνατον τῶν ἁμαρτωλῶν ὡς τὸ ἐπιστρέψαι καὶ ζῇν αὐτοὺς, ἀποδεξάμενός σου τῆς ψυχῆς τὴν προθυμίαν, χαρίσηταί σοι τὴν ἄφεσιν τῆς ἁμαρτίας· ἡμεῖς δὲ ὑπὲρ τῶν εἰρημένων αἶνον καὶ δόξαν ἀναπέμπωμεν τῷ Πατρὶ καὶ τῷ Υἱῷ καὶ τῷ ἁγίῳ Πνεύματι, νῦν καὶ ἀεὶ, καὶ εἰς τοὺς αἰῶνας τῶν αἰώνων. Ἀμήν.
